Guelph Transit 229 was a Nova Bus LFS 40102 bus built in 1997 for the Hamilton Street Railway as 9717. In July 2011, Guelph city council approved the offer by MTB Transit Solutions for one refurbished secondhand bus at a price of approximately $125,000. The bus was purchased in September 2011. This is the first second hand bus since 2008.

The bus had seating for 35 passengers with spaces for wheelchairs available by folding seats. A new Ricon flip-out wheelchair ramp was installed at a widened front door (52 inches) by MTB, and the ramp at the rear door was removed. Mechanical components were overhauled and the exterior was left in the ghost livery until the end of October; Then was put into the Guelph livery and a bike rack was installed. New flooring was installed and the bus was re-powered with new a engine and transmission. It was renumbered from 225 to 229 in December of 2011.
